Understanding Grade A vs Grade B Pallets
When buying used pallets in Columbia SC, you will likely hear terms such as grade A vs B pallets. These grades reflect condition and structural quality.
What Are Grade A Pallets
Grade A pallets are also known as premium recycled pallets. They typically:
- Have limited repairs
- Contain clean, solid deck boards
- Maintain consistent dimensions
- Show minimal cosmetic damage
Grade A pallets are ideal for customer-facing shipments or retail distribution where appearance matters.
What Are Grade B Pallets
Grade B pallets may show visible repairs or replaced boards. They:
- May contain plugs or companion stringers
- Shows more wear than Grade A
- Still meets load-bearing requirements
Grade B pallets are often suitable for internal warehouse use, storage, or one-way shipping.
Before choosing between grade A vs B pallets, consider how the pallet will be used. For example, high-visibility retail shipments may require cleaner pallets, while internal warehouse storage may not.
Used Pallet Buyers Should Always Follow a Quality Checklist
Professional used pallet buyers never rely on price alone. Instead, they use a pallet quality checklist to evaluate each batch.
Here are essential inspection points:
Check Structural Integrity
Inspect stringers and deck boards for cracks or splits. The pallet should not bend under light pressure. Damaged stringers reduce pallet durability and increase risk during forklift handling.
Look for Loose Nails
Loose or protruding nails can damage products and injure workers. A reliable pallet supplier Columbia SC should ensure pallets are properly repaired before resale.
Confirm Standard Dimensions
Most warehouses use standard sizes such as the common grocery pallet dimension. Confirm measurements to ensure compatibility with racking systems and trailers.
Inspect for Contamination
Avoid pallets that show signs of oil, chemical spills, or excessive moisture. Clean pallets protect product integrity and meet warehouse safety standards.
Review Repair Quality
If boards have been replaced, check whether repairs are secure and properly aligned. Poor repairs weaken pallet durability over time.
Following this pallet quality checklist reduces operational risk and improves long-term value.
Evaluating Pallet Durability for Your Operation
Pallet durability depends on load weight, handling frequency, and storage conditions. Therefore, you should match pallet type to operational demands.
Consider these factors:
- Average weight per pallet load
- Frequency of forklift movement
- Indoor or outdoor storage
- Shipping distance
For example, manufacturing facilities with heavy equipment parts may require stronger pallets than light retail goods storage.

When Used Pallets Are Not the Right Choice
Although used pallets provide value, some situations require new pallets. For example:
- Export shipments requiring heat treatment
- High-visibility retail displays
- Specialized dimensions
